Indian Bank Revises Benchmark Lending Rates
AI Summary
Indian Bank's Asset Liability Management Committee (ALCO) has decided to revise its Treasury Bills Linked Lending Rate (TBLR). The rates for tenors greater than 3 months and up to 1 year have been reduced. Specifically, the TBLR for tenors between >3 months & <=6 months is now 5.50% (down from 5.55%), and for tenors between >6 months & <=1 year, it is 5.65% (down from 5.85%). Rates for <=3 months tenor remain unchanged at 5.30%. Rates for >1 year & <=3 Years have also been revised to 5.65%. The revised TBLR is effective from August 3, 2026. Marginal Cost of funds based Lending Rate (MCLR), Base Rate, and Benchmark Prime Lending Rate (BPLR) remain unchanged.
